Common procedures performed by a cosmetic dentist

Whitening

Cosmetic dentists are usually the best type of dentist to see when it comes to teeth whitening. This common cosmetic dental procedure can be done in one appointment, and the results can be immediate. Cosmetic dentists often perform whitening treatments because they focus on the way that the teeth look.

A teeth whitening procedure can be completed in less than an hour. The cosmetic dentist will thoroughly clean the teeth, apply a whitening solution and then use a strong light to cure the bleaching agents.

Dental bonding

A common cosmetic dental procedure that is regularly performed by cosmetic dentists is dental bonding. This simple procedure allows teeth to be altered in shape or size. If a person has a chip or a crack in their tooth that is minor, then dental bonding is a great solution.

Cosmetic dentists encourage dental bonding when a person wants to change the way that a tooth looks, without having to undergo an involved procedure. All that is involved in this non-invasive procedure is an application of resin and a curing light.

Dental veneers

Another procedure that cosmetic dentists often perform is the placement of dental veneers. These wafer-thin shells are placed over teeth that are severely stained, minorly damaged or even misshapen. This cosmetic dental procedure is non-invasive and doesn’t involve a lot of discomfort, other than sensitivity.

Veneers can be created to match the surrounding teeth but they are unable to be bleached. Thus, cosmetic dentists often recommend that a person has their teeth bleached beforehand so that the veneer matches the teeth's brighter, white color.
